Hedge fund buying doubles Minneapolis Grain Exchange seat prices
April 28, 2014 at 17:46 PM EDT
CHICAGO, April 28 (Reuters) - Hedge fund manager Murray Stahl has bought 13 percent of the seats on the last independent U.S. grain exchange, doubling prices and fueling speculation he may want a platform to trade his fund's products or even to cash in on a potential takeover, industry sources said on Monday.
